The easy jobs will take care of themselves. - Dale Carnegie Re: Is it a good floor plan? Please advice 17Jun 08, 2008 12:04 am Your laundry seems out of place. Looks like you'd have to walk through half the house with a wet load of washing in order to take it outside to hang it up for drying. Or have you a door to the outside from the laundry?
At any rate having the laundry amongst the bedroom is a tad unusual and I'd imagine could restrict you from popping a load in at night for fear of waking someone up? Just a thought... Please advice 18Jun 08, 2008 8:47 am Rapacious, simpson has already said there is outside access thru the laundry so wet washing goes straight out the laundry door to outside.
I disagree with your other comment about laundry position, many single story houses have laundries in the bedroom area and this design is better than many as the wall on which the washing machine would go is not directly against a bedroom wall, therefore minimal noise disruption.
